Pakistan and Saudi Arabia on Sunday reaffirmed their commitment to expand cooperation in the energy sector and agreed to further strengthen bilateral economic ties.
The decision came during a meeting between Federal Finance Minister Muhammad Aurangzeb, Energy Minister Sardar Awais Ahmad Khan Leghari and Saudi Finance Minister Mohammed bin Abdullah Al-Jadaan.
The meeting focused on strengthening the economic partnership between Pakistan and Saudi Arabia and expanding cooperation in the energy sector.
The two sides also agreed to continue consultations and maintain close coordination on issues of common interest to promote cooperation in key sectors.
The Ministers welcomed the growing partnership between Pakistan and Saudi Arabia and reiterated their resolve to further deepen economic and energy cooperation through sustained engagement and close bilateral coordination.
